SUMMARY

The Laboratory Supervisor supervises day-to-day operations including accuracy for patient results, instrumentation, quality and regulatory issues, procedures, and processes as appropriate. The Laboratory Supervisor also oversees Laboratory Medical Technologists and Support Staff as necessary and performs bench work as a Medical Technologist as needed.

R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Manages the day-to-day activities of the Laboratory Section
  • Technical Supervision: Oversee appropriate scheduling of Department staff and daily operations and workflow. Assure that Department procedures and instruments conform to good laboratory practice. Assure validity of patient test results. Oversee information technology needs specific to the department, including updates and staff training
  • Human Resource Management: Work with Department Manager to interview, hire, train, supervise, discipline and terminate Department team member with appropriate documentation. Maintain Department files according to regulatory requirements and review files annually for completeness. Complete annual performance evaluations for Department staff. Foster teamwork and a collegial atmosphere
  • Materials Management: Maintain equipment and supplies. Confer with vendors to obtain best pricing, quality, etc, and monitor preventive maintenance on equipment
  • Regulatory Compliance: Adhere to all regulatory standards and prepare Department for inspections. Work with Department Manager and Physician Director to develop, monitor and complete appropriate Department QA, QC and QI monitors
  • Training and Competency: Provide orientation, training, on-going education and competency assessments specific to Department. Participate in continuing education program for Department staff. Assist with teaching in the Clinical Laboratory Technology Program
  • Perform bench work as needed
  • Demonstrates commitment to RRH Standards
  • Performs additional duties and responsibilities as requested by Manager or Director

REQUIRED QUALIFICATIONS:

  • BS in Medical Technology or BS in a related Science and/or equivalent relevant experience as recognized by New York State Department of Education for licensure as a Clinical Laboratory Technologist (NYS Dept. of Education, Education Law, article 165, 8605-9/1/06)
  • Minimum 4 + years' experience as a Medical Technologist
  • Current New York State Department of Education License or Limited Permit as a Clinical Laboratory Technologist
  • Successful completion as appropriate of NYS Licensing examination in fulfillment of requirements for the NYS Clinical Laboratory Technologist license
  • Must meet New York State Department of Health CLEP requirements as a Laboratory Supervisor
  • Must have a valid NYS driver’s license

P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S:

  • 4+ years of experience in Chemistry
  • Previous experience in laboratory leadership position preferred
  • Certification by ASCP preferred, but not required

P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S: M - Medium Work - Exerting 20 to 50 pounds of force occasionally, and/or 10 to 25 pounds of force frequently, and/or greater than negligible up to 10 pounds of force constantly to move objects; Requires frequent walking, standing or squatting.
